media-tv/zapping-0.7 fails to merge due to file collision when strict is enabled. Reproducible: Always Steps to Reproduce: 1. Add strict to FEATURES in /etc/make.conf. 2. ACCEPT_KEYWORDS="~x86" emerge zapping Actual Results: >>> Completed installing zapping-0.7 into /var/tmp/portage/zapping-0.7/image/ * checking 120 files for package collisions existing file /var/lib/scrollkeeper/scrollkeeper_docs is not owned by this package existing file /var/lib/scrollkeeper/C/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/C/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/am/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/am/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/be/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/be/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/ca/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/ca/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/az/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/az/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/da/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/da/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/de/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/de/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/cs/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/cs/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/el/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/el/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/es/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/es/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/fr/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/fr/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/hu/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/hu/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/ja/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/ja/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/it/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/it/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/kn/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/kn/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/ko/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/ko/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/nl/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/nl/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/no/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/no/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/pl/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/pl/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/ro/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/ro/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/ru/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/ru/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/sk/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/sk/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/sl/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/sl/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/sr/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/sr/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/sv/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/sv/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/tr/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/tr/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/uk/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/uk/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/vi/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/vi/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/pt_BR/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/pt_BR/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/zh_CN/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/zh_CN/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/zh_TW/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/zh_TW/scrollkeeper_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/sr@Latn/scrollkeeper_extended_cl.xml is not owned by this package existing file /var/lib/scrollkeeper/sr@Latn/scrollkeeper_cl.xml is not owned by this package * spent 0.197212934494 seconds checking for file collisions * This package is blocked because it wants to overwrite * files belonging to other packages (see messages above). * If you have no clue what this is all about report it * as a bug for this package on http://bugs.gentoo.org package media-tv/zapping-0.7 NOT merged Expected Results: The package should merge fine. Portage 2.0.51.22-r1 (default-linux/x86/2005.0, gcc-3.3.5-20050130, glibc-2.3.4. 20041102-r1, 2.6.10-gentoo-r6 i686) ================================================================= System uname: 2.6.10-gentoo-r6 i686 AMD Athlon(TM) XP 2000+ Gentoo Base System version 1.6.12 dev-lang/python: 2.3.5 sys-apps/sandbox: 1.2.10 sys-devel/autoconf: 2.13, 2.59-r6 sys-devel/automake: 1.4_p6, 1.5, 1.6.3, 1.7.9-r1, 1.8.5-r3, 1.9.5 sys-devel/binutils: 2.15.92.0.2-r10 sys-devel/libtool: 1.5.18-r1 virtual/os-headers: 2.6.11-r2 ACCEPT_KEYWORDS="x86" AUTOCLEAN="yes" CBUILD="i686-pc-linux-gnu" CFLAGS="-march=athlon-xp -O3 -fomit-frame-pointer -pipe" CHOST="i686-pc-linux-gnu" CONFIG_PROTECT="/etc /usr/kde/2/share/config /usr/kde/3/share/config /usr/lib/ X11/xkb /usr/lib/mozilla/defaults/pref /usr/share/config /usr/share/texmf/ dvipdfm/config/ /usr/share/texmf/dvips/config/ /usr/share/texmf/tex/generic/ config/ /usr/share/texmf/tex/platex/config/ /usr/share/texmf/xdvi/ /var/qmail/ control" CONFIG_PROTECT_MASK="/etc/gconf /etc/terminfo /etc/env.d" CXXFLAGS="-march=athlon-xp -O3 -fomit-frame-pointer -pipe" DISTDIR="/usr/portage/distfiles" FEATURES="autoconfig ccache collision-protect distlocks sandbox sfperms strict userpriv usersandbox" GENTOO_MIRRORS="ftp://mirror.pudas.net/gentoo http://distfiles.gentoo.org http:/ /www.ibiblio.org/pub/Linux/distributions/gentoo" LC_ALL="C" MAKEOPTS="-j2" PKGDIR="/usr/portage/packages" PORTAGE_TMPDIR="/var/tmp" PORTDIR="/usr/portage" SYNC="rsync://rsync.europe.gentoo.org/gentoo-portage" USE="x86 3dnow 3dnowext X a52 aac alsa apm avi bitmap-fonts bzip2 cjk crypt cscope cups dga dts dv dvd dvdread emboss encode fam ffmpeg flac foomaticdb gif gimpprint gpm gtk gtk2 imagemagick imlib ipv6 jpeg lcms libg++ libwww mad matroska matrox md5sum mikmod mjpeg mmx mmxext mng mp3 mpeg ncurses nls nptl nvidia ogg oggvorbis opengl oss pam pcre pda pdflib png qt quicktime quotas readline real rtc samba sdl speex spell sse ssl svg tcpd tga theora threads tiff truetype truetype-fonts type1-fonts unicode v4l v4l2 vidix vorbis win32codecs wmf xine xinerama xml2 xprint xv xvid xvmc zlib userland_GNU kernel_linux elibc_glibc" Unset: ASFLAGS, CTARGET, LANG, LDFLAGS, LINGUAS, PORTDIR_OVERLAY
*** Bug 98969 has been marked as a duplicate of this bug. ***
*** Bug 98970 has been marked as a duplicate of this bug. ***
*** Bug 98971 has been marked as a duplicate of this bug. ***
*** Bug 98972 has been marked as a duplicate of this bug. ***
zapping should use the gnome2 eclass and be fixed anyway, cause gnome-2 apps do not need glade-1 includes for example. This is obviously a bump without even checking the basics of the ebuild.
This package obviously needs some maintainer, re-assigned.
Fixed in cvs. Thanks for reporting!